Transaction 02384848ee81bedde6cfd6eb6781b23ba439750837751dc9f627d74310b68e8b
1 Input
1 Output
-
02384848ee81bedde6cfd6eb6781b23ba439750837751dc9f627d74310b68e8b:0
- value
- 383539
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b02ac6358cd9bcbdfe2fd5d8ce2318538733d61
- address
- bc1q8vp2cc6cekduhhlzl4wcec33s5u8x0tpjphw4y